Impression wrapper
Technical field
The present invention relates to a kind of dixie cup process equipment, specifically a kind of impression wrapper.
Technical background
Current social, the application of dixie cup is the most universal.For playing heat insulation comfortable effect, a Concha Arcae of fitting outside dixie cup Overcoat, forms corrugated paper cup, is widely used.On Vehicles Collected from Market, formed corrugated coat fan-shaped corrugated board sheet by basic unit and watt Stupefied layer two layers of paper synthesize, often individually produce, institute's consumption material is many, long processing time, labor intensive are many, complex process, not environmentally, With high costs.

The operation principle of impression wrapper is: 1, inhale mechanism of paper and the scraps of paper are drawn into workbench;2, the scraps of paper arrive marking press Structure, forms wash boarding by the extruding of the original monolayer sector scraps of paper;3, after impression operation completes, paper feeding slew gear will extrude shape The scraps of paper becoming wash boarding send creasing mechanism to daub mechanism;4, machine daub mechanism is extruding the scraps of paper limit forming wash boarding Originate from dynamic sprayed glues;5, the corrugated board sheet being complete daub operation is held tightly on circle mould by cylinder shaping mechanism, and by the scraps of paper Fit in edge, cup cylinder molding;6, cup cylinder is by drawing cup mechanism to enter cup shaping mechanism, top cylinder mechanical hand from cup cylinder shaping mechanism Being inserted by cup cylinder and connect cup cylinder station, cup cylinder forwards to be compressed by cup cylinder by compression cup cylinder mechanism after compression cup cylinder station, then goes to one Secondary volume basic skill or training position and secondary volume basic skill or training position, at twice to needing the cup cylinder rolling up the end to do the volume end, then go to whirl coating station, at whirl coating Throw away glue to cup cylinder inwall under mechanism's effect, then go to a glass station, interior cup is fallen into cup cylinder, then go to a compression cup Station and secondary compression cup station, combine cup cylinder and interior cup and be adjacent to, be turning finally to out a glass station, under going out cup mechanism effect, become The impression cup of type flies out from pipeline, fulfils assignment.
